Cogs = (beg fg + cogm) end fg. Beg fg + cogm is the pool of fg costs (previous year + current year) either sold or unsold at end of year. Cogm = (beg wip + manufacturing costs incurred) end wip. Beg wip + manuf. costs incurred is the pool of wip costs (previous year + current year) Manuf. costs incurred = dm used + dl used + moh allocated. Dm used = (beg rm + purchases) end rm. Moh rate(plantwide) = [estimated total annual moh costs / estimated total annual units of allocation base] Traditional approach: single plantwide allocation rate: provides reasonably accurate costs allocations if company, produces limited variety of similar products, and, single factor (ex. Dl hours) is primary driver of moh costs.
